« ChainLP V0.39-8 | トップページ | ChainLP V0.39-10 »

ChainLP V0.39-9

ChainLP v0.39-9

■何をするもの?
連番画像を指定サイズにリサイズし、画像だけの電子ブック形式ファイル(LRF、PDF、ePub、Mobi)として出力します。連番ファイルやZIP、 LHaを作成することもできます。
青空文庫形式のテキストファイルを縦書き画像に変換することもできます。このとき、PDF仮想プリンタまたはiTextSharpを使用して、フォント埋め込みのPDFを出力することもできます。

 「ChainLP39b9.zip」をダウンロード

■変更のポイント

PDF直接出力でも目次が出力されるようになりました。
また、青空バッチを使うと、複数の青空文庫ファイルを一つのファイルにまとめて出力できるようになりました。

■ランタイムについて

実行するためには、Microsoft.NET framework 4.0というランタイム・ライブラリが
前もってインストールされている必要があります。
http://www.microsoft.com/downloads/details.aspx?FamilyID=9cfb2d51-5ff4-4491-b0e5-b386f32c0992&displaylang=ja

■使用上の注意
ePubを作成するために、zip32j.dll+zip32.dllを使用しています。
統合アーカイバ・プロジェクトのホームページ からダウンロードして下さい。
http://www.csdinc.co.jp/archiver/lib/zip32j.html

※64bit-OSの場合は、dllのコピー先はC:\System\System32ではなく、
C:\System\SysWOW64になりますので、注意して下さい。
分からない場合はChianLPを解凍したフォルダに置いて下さい。

■PDF直接出力(フォント埋め込みPDF)について

PDF直接出力に対応するため、iTextSharpライブラリを使用させて頂きました。
以下のサイトからDLして、iTextSharp.dllをChainLPを解凍したフォルダに置いて下さい。
http://sourceforge.jp/projects/sfnet_itextsharp/

※このバージョンで使用しているのはitextsharp-5.0.5-dll.zipです。バージョンはなるべく合わせて下さい。動作しない場合があります。

■履歴

0.39-9 2011/01/29
・青空テキストの自動エンコーディングを指定しているとき、エンコーディングが判別できない場合はSHIFT-JISを仮定するようにしました。
・「<>削除」と「<img>使用」が逆になっていたのを修正しました。
・青空文庫でPDF直接出力を設定しているときに、挿絵に対してページ補正や縦横比チェックのプレビューが効いてしまう不具合を修正しました。
・PDF直接出力のとき、挿絵のみガンマ補正とシャープネスが効くようにしました。
・BatchLPにて1ファイル処理する度に実行ログを消去していましたが、消去せずに連続して表示するようにしました。
・目次設定に「次の目次」と「前の目次」ボタンを追加しました。
・PDF直接出力に目次が反映されるようにしました。
・青空バッチにて複数の青空文庫ファイルを一つのファイルとして結合出力できるようにしました。

|

« ChainLP V0.39-8 | トップページ | ChainLP V0.39-10 »

ツール」カテゴリの記事

ChainLP」カテゴリの記事

コメント

いつも更新お疲れ様です。
No.722さんのソフトは大変重宝しております。
ありがとう。

投稿: jindash496 | 2011年1月29日 (土) 23時15分

2chで目次の件を書いた者です。
ありがとうございます。
ますます使いやすくなりました。

投稿: | 2011年1月31日 (月) 19時32分

便利なソフトをありがとうございます。
gaiji.iniから呼び出される外字のうち、
表示位置が上方にずれているものがあるので
ご報告しておきます。

ざっと確認したところ、濁点付き平仮名・片仮名、
丸付き文字、「(株)」などがずれていました。
漢字系のものはちゃんと真ん中に表示されています。

投稿: | 2011年2月 5日 (土) 11時36分

説明書きに、epub出力時にzip32j.dll+zip32.dllが必要と書いてあるけど、
圧縮ファイル読み込み時にunzip32.dllが必要だ、とは書いてないというのは手落ちなのでは?
エラーメッセージが表示されるから実害はないけど。

投稿: | 2011年2月 9日 (水) 15時00分

この記事へのコメントは終了しました。

« ChainLP V0.39-8 | トップページ | ChainLP V0.39-10 »